Osu Oxford Street, often referred to as the "West End" of Accra, is a vibrant, bustling thoroughfare at the heart of the lively Osu district. Known as the city's most energetic street, it offers an exciting blend of shopping, dining, entertainment, and cultural experiences, drawing locals and tourists alike.

Osu Oxford Street is a hub for retail therapy, boasting everything from upscale boutiques like Monte-Carlo, which features exclusive collections from international designers, to neighborhood kiosks showcasing Ghana's rich cultural heritage through trinkets and handmade accessories. Supermarkets such as Koala cater to household essentials, making it a favorite for both residents and visitors.

When the sun sets, Osu Oxford Street transforms into a nightlife haven. Modern nightclubs such as Makumba and Ryan’s Irish Pub offer lively atmospheres, with free ladies' nights adding to their charm. Street performances, including acrobatics and live music, enhance the vibrant weekend energy, making it a must-visit for those seeking fun and entertainment.

The street connects to Ring Road via a roundabout honoring Dr. J. B. Danquah, a revered Ghanaian figure. Annually, the street hosts a grand carnival, drawing crowds to celebrate Ghanaian culture and unity.

Osu Oxford Street seamlessly combines the modern with the traditional. Alongside international designer boutiques and electronic shops like Sony Centre and Somovision Ghana, the kiosks on the sidewalks serve as a reminder of Ghana's rich cultural roots. Whether you're searching for high-tech gadgets or handcrafted artifacts, the street caters to every need.
